He then adds: “You are nothing natural, my friend”, before commanding Theta to get David’s wife and two children. ![]() Technology allows the two men to jump into their duplicant bodies every now and again, meaning they can revisit their partners and kids. ![]() Their original human form has been sent up into space on a six-year mission, while their clones live on Earth with their respective families. “Beyond The Sea” – starring Josh Hartnett, Aaron Paul and Kate Mara – imagines a parallel world taking place in the 1960s, in which two astronauts are turned into replicants.
